    Hi @Danw87 - & welcome to the community.
    The DWP are only looking at cases where an award was decided between 6 April 2016 & 17 September 2020, & only those cases where a potential 2 more points means an award for the daily living component might be given, or if someone could have got an enhanced award rather than just standard.
    The DWP say they will contact you if potentially more points would change things.
